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48863 3293 334691316 31849572037
7246584 4828
7246584 4828
34014656 5661 56 60
All about undefined
Interested in learning more?
7246584 4828
34014656 5661 56 60
See more
731788 19454311 3449370
2475 9117638607 187501195
See more
64168208 56464393257
825321 60302 793 6357455
See more